Haydock 12.30 - Conditional Jockeys Handicap Hurdle - Class 4 - 3 miles and 1/2 furlong - 11 run - Heavy
 
I think conditions will be a great leveller here over the longer trips and at the top of the market I'd not see Apple Away who is unproven in the ground, Ballymagroarty Boy, who is a decent horse but who has clearly had training issues in the past as being particularly good value although SHIGHNESS who is in the Tracker and who has form in the ground is probably the one to beat here for Micky Hammond and Emma Smith-Chaston IF you want a win saver.
 
Harjo is an ex 3 mile P2P horse and we can be pretty sure that Lily Pinchin will ride it from the front and try to stretch them but it's another as yet unproven in heavy ground. The same Going concerns apply to Lily Glitters from the Henry Daly yard who are always dangerous at Haydock.
 
I think there is therefore real value and some actually solid form lines to suggest that those at bigger prices may outrun them.
 
MR HARP has a win back in 2020 in heavy ground at Uttoxeter off a mark of 115 and then placed off marks of 123 and 126 in similar conditions and runs off a mark of 104. GOLDEN COSMOS for Richard Newland has form in Ireland that really does suggest that this trip and underfoot conditions are optimum and its running off a declining mark and should be more competitive here and HAPPY HOLLOW for Jennie Candlish, another to always keep an eye on here, is 9lbs below it's last winning mark attained in the mud..
 
I think it's worth speculating on that trio and have the "win saver" on Shighness if you wish and maybe play a few Tricast lines for a big possible reward.

Haydock 3.00 Handicap Chase - Class 2 - 3 miles 4 and 1/2 furlongs - 12 run - Heavy
 
I'll apply some similar logic here.
 
At the head of the market there are clear reasons why the likes of Conqueredallofeurope, Morning Spirit, Hold That Thought, Good Boy Bobby, Jimmy The Digger, Engarde and Danilo D'Airy would have very solid claims on Soft Going. They all have ability and whilst some are unproven beyond 3 miles and some prefer Softer going, I frankly can't see any of them being "bottomed out for the season" once they show any signs of distress and I think it's one of those races where we'll see a host pulled up as they turn in and hit the stamina wall and saved for another more likely day.
 
I think therefore there is value in some proven mudlarks and plodders who can stay on down the straight and win a nice prize here.
 
I like Sams Adventure and fear it but despite the Course win a recent wind op is a niggle in such conditions. It will be my reserve in case either SAMUEL JACKSON or NICEANDEASY don't' run. I think both are suited by conditions and could be well backed once the penny drops so try and get on early if you can. Both have little weight to carry off competitive marks and clear evidence that if they can get in to a rhythm they can get the trip in the mud.
